Mattress pads, especially those designed for cribs and baby products, are essential bedding accessories that serve several purposes in a nursery. Here's what you should know about them:
Protection: A crib mattress pad acts as a protective barrier between the crib mattress and your baby. It helps guard against spills, accidents, and diaper leaks, keeping the mattress clean and free from stains.
Comfort: Many crib mattress pads are made from soft and comfortable materials, such as cotton or polyester. These materials can add a layer of cushioning to the baby's sleep surface, making it more comfortable for them.
Hygiene: Babies can be messy, and crib mattress pads are easy to remove and machine wash. This makes them a practical choice for maintaining a hygienic sleeping environment for your baby.
Waterproof: Some crib mattress pads are designed to be waterproof or water-resistant. This feature is particularly helpful in preventing liquids from seeping through to the mattress and causing damage.
Breathability: Look for mattress pads with breathable materials to help regulate your baby's temperature.Proper airflow is essential for preventing overheating, especially for infants.
Fit: It's important to choose a crib mattress pad that fits snugly over the crib mattress. A secure fit prevents the pad from shifting around or creating a suffocation hazard.
Hypoallergenic Options: If your baby has allergies or sensitive skin, you can find hypoallergenic crib mattress pads that are designed to reduce allergen exposure and skin irritation.
Ease of Cleaning: Opt for mattress pads that are easy to clean and maintain. Most are machine washable, but check the care instructions to ensure they meet your needs.
Versatility: Some crib mattress pads are designed to serve multiple functions. They may be reversible, with one side being waterproof and the other soft and comfortable, offering flexibility depending on your needs.
Safety: Ensure that the crib mattress pad you choose complies with safety standards and regulations for baby bedding. This includes avoiding any loose or potentially hazardous components.
Durability: High-quality crib mattress pads are durable and can withstand regular washing and use throughout your baby's early years.
Noise Levels: Some mattress pads can make noise when the baby moves on them. Consider this factor if you're concerned about waking your child during the night.
In summary, crib mattress pads are essential nursery accessories that provide protection, comfort, and hygiene for your baby's sleeping environment. When selecting a mattress pad, consider factors such as fit, material, waterproofing, and ease of cleaning to ensure it meets your baby's needs and safety standards.
